Meaning of "Lara"

Female first name (German, Russian): go back to the old Roman nickname of 'Lawrence': 'the out of town Laurentium stem end, Lara; Latin (Geographic name as first name); laurus = the laurel, the laurel wreath, information on male form Lorenz ', later called' reinterpreted as 'the laurel Laurus' with laurel wreath as a symbol of victory / the winner Lara is a short form of feminine names Laura and Larissa. Laura means bay or laurel wreath.
